What is a Home Based Masters in Animal Science?

A Home Based Masters in Animal Science is a graduate-level degree program that allows students to study animal biology, nutrition, genetics, and management from the comfort of their own home, typically through online coursework. These programs are designed for individuals who need flexibility due to work, family, or geographic constraints. Students can access lectures, complete assignments, and interact with instructors and peers virtually. Upon completion, graduates are prepared for careers in animal research, agriculture, education, or to pursue further studies such as a PhD.

What can I do with a master's degree in animal science?

A master's degree in animal science prepares individuals for careers such as animal nutritionist, research scientist, livestock manager, or animal technician. Graduates often work in research facilities, farms, or industry settings, utilizing skills in animal health, nutrition, and management, and may pursue certifications or advanced roles in the field.

Is a master's degree in animal science worth it?

A master's degree in animal science can enhance job prospects for roles such as animal scientist or research technician by providing advanced knowledge and research skills. It may lead to higher salaries and opportunities in academia, industry, or government, but the value depends on career goals and industry demand.

What is the highest paying job in animal science?

In animal science, the highest paying roles are often senior research scientists, veterinary specialists, or animal nutritionists, with salaries exceeding $100,000 annually. These positions typically require advanced degrees, specialized skills, and experience working in research institutions, pharmaceutical companies, or large agricultural firms.

Position Overview (All Levels)
Team members provide high-quality husbandry and care to laboratory animals while supporting critical cancer research. Responsibilities include animal care, health monitoring, regulatory compliance, and collaboration with veterinary and research teams.
Career Levels & Pay
🔹 Research Animal Care Technician Associate (Entry Level)
Starting Pay: $20.50/hour
Ideal for those beginning a career in laboratory animal science.
Highlights:
Learn foundational skills in animal husbandry and care
Perform basic health checks and cage maintenance
Support sanitation, cage wash, and facility operations
Gain exposure to research environments and procedures
Qualifications:
High School Diploma/GED + 2 years of animal care experience
or a degree in Animal Science (or related field) with 1 year of experience
🔹 Research Animal Care Technician (Mid-Level)
Starting Pay: $21.50/hour
For experienced professionals with research animal care experience.
Highlights:
Independently perform husbandry and welfare monitoring
Support breeding, treatments, and research protocols
Ensure regulatory compliance and animal welfare standards
Collaborate with veterinary staff and investigators
Qualifications:
4 years of animal care experience, including 1 year in research animal care
🔹 Senior Research Animal Care Technician
Starting Pay: $23.50/hour
For advanced technicians with specialized and leadership capabilities.
Highlights:
Perform advanced procedures (e.g., injections, gavage, study support)
Lead breeding services and technical support activities
Assist with training and process improvements
Support SOP development and operational excellence
Typical Qualifications:
Associate's degree + 4 years experience (including 2 years research animal care)
or High School Diploma + 6 years experience (including 2 years research animal care).
Advanced technical skills; AALAS certification preferred
What You'll Do (All Levels)
Provide daily husbandry: feeding, watering, and cage sanitation
Monitor animal health and report concerns
Maintain accurate records and census data
Support research activities, including breeding and technical services (level-dependent)
Follow regulatory and safety protocols
Work collaboratively in a fast-paced research environment
